32. Measuring Impact: Approaches and Tools.

Introduction

Measuring the impact of educational technology (EdTech) is crucial for understanding its effectiveness in improving learning outcomes and guiding future enhancements. It involves using various approaches and tools to gather data on user engagement, learning progress, and overall educational impact. This section explores different methodologies and tools that EdTech companies can use to measure the impact of their solutions accurately and effectively.

Defining Impact Metrics

  1. Goal-Specific Metrics: Establishing clear metrics based on the specific goals of the EdTech solution, such as increased engagement, improved learning outcomes, or enhanced digital literacy.
  2. Balanced Scorecard Approach: Utilizing a balanced scorecard approach that includes diverse metrics like user satisfaction, academic performance, and teacher adoption rates.

Quantitative Measurement Tools

  1. Analytics Platforms: Utilizing analytics platforms to track user engagement, time spent on tasks, and completion rates.
  2. Standardized Assessments: Implementing standardized tests and quizzes to measure learning gains and academic improvements.

Qualitative Measurement Approaches

  1. User Surveys and Interviews: Conducting surveys and interviews with students, teachers, and other stakeholders to gather qualitative feedback on the EdTech solution.
  2. Case Studies: Developing case studies that provide in-depth insights into the usage and impact of the solution in various educational settings.

Longitudinal Studies

  1. Tracking Over Time: Conducting longitudinal studies to understand the impact of the EdTech solution over an extended period.
  2. Comparative Analysis: Comparing data from before and after the implementation of the EdTech solution to gauge its effectiveness.

Technology-Enhanced Assessment Tools

  1. Adaptive Testing: Using adaptive testing tools that adjust the difficulty of questions based on the learner’s responses.
  2. Learning Analytics: Employing learning analytics to track and analyze individual learner’s interactions and progress.

Feedback Loops and Continuous Improvement

  1. Feedback Mechanisms: Establishing mechanisms for regular feedback from users to continuously refine and improve the EdTech solution.
  2. Iterative Design: Applying an iterative approach to product development, incorporating user feedback and impact assessment findings.

Third-Party Evaluations and Audits

  1. Independent Evaluations: Engaging third-party organizations to conduct independent evaluations of the EdTech solution.
  2. Audit Reports: Utilizing audit reports to provide an objective assessment of the solution’s impact.

Social Impact Measurement

  1. Social Return on Investment (SROI): Calculating the social return on investment to understand the broader social impact of the EdTech solution.
  2. Community Feedback: Gathering feedback from the wider community, including parents and local organizations.

Utilizing Data Visualization Tools

  1. Interactive Dashboards: Creating interactive dashboards to visualize data and trends in user engagement and learning outcomes.
  2. Data Storytelling: Employing data storytelling techniques to communicate the impact of the EdTech solution to stakeholders.

Conclusion

Measuring the impact of EdTech solutions requires a combination of quantitative and qualitative approaches, backed by reliable tools and methodologies. By effectively measuring their impact, EdTech companies can demonstrate their value, make informed improvements, and contribute significantly to advancing education through technology.
